Miguel Díaz Vargas: una modernidad invisible

Halim Badawi Quesada; Luisa Fernanda Ordóñez Ortegón; María Clara Cortés Polanía; Paula Matiz Silva; Ruth Nohemí Acuña Prieto; William Alfonso López Rosas;

The book Miguel Díaz Vargas: una modernidad invisible has been registred with the ISBN 978-958-98419-8-3 in Agencia Colombiana del ISBN. This book has been published by Fundación Gilberto Alzate Avendaño in 2008 in the city Bogota, in Colombia.
